OBJECTIVES: New training methods such as simulation have been introduced in cardiology as in other specialties; however, the development of effective simulation-based training programs is challenging. They are often unstructured and based on convenience or coincidence. The objective of this study was to perform a nationwide general needs assessment to identify and prioritize technical procedures that should be included in a simulation-based curriculum for cardiology residency in Denmark. DESIGN: We completed a needs assessment using the Delphi method among key opinion leaders in cardiology. Brainstorming in round 1 identified technical procedures that future cardiologists should learn. Round 2 was a survey to examine frequency of procedure, number of cardiologists performing the procedure, operator-related risk and/or discomfort for patients and feasibility for simulation. Round 3 was final elimination and prioritization of procedures. RESULTS: Ninety-four key opinion leaders were included, and the response rates were 77% (round 1), 62% (Round 2), and 68% (Round 3). Twenty-four technical procedures were identified in Round 1 and pre-prioritized in Round 2. In round 3, 13 procedures were included in the final prioritized list. The five highly prioritized procedures eligible for simulation-based training were advanced life support, pleurocentesis, transesophageal echocardiography, coronary angiography, and pericardiocentesis. CONCLUSION: The general needs assessment following the Delphi process identified and prioritized 13 technical procedures in cardiology that should be integrated in a simulation-based curriculum. The final list provides educators a guide when developing simulation-based training programmes for cardiology residents.

Magnetic resonance imaging (CMR) is applied in mitral valve regurgitation (MR) to quantify regurgitation volume/fraction and cardiac volumes, but individual scallop pathology is evaluated by echocardiography. To evaluate CMR for determination of individual scallop pathology, interrater variability on evaluation of scallop pathology from echocardiography and a standard clinical CMR protocol including a transversal stack was compared. 318 mitral scallops from 53 patients with primary MR were evaluated by two cardiologists evaluating echocardiography scans and two other cardiologists evaluating CMR scans (blinded). Inter-rater variability was determined with percentage agreement and Cohen's kappa. In evaluable scallops, interrater agreement on the diagnosis of a prolapsing and/or flail scallop was 77-87% and kappa values of 0.27-0.67, irrespective of physician or modality. Important differences between modalities were primarily related to CMR-evaluators judging the A3 and the P3 to be normal when echocardiography demonstrated prolapsing or even flail scallops; poor imaging of calcification; and flailed scallops occasionally being undetected with CMR since the flow-voids may mask the scallop. Inter-rater agreement for scallop pathology in primary MR is comparable for echocardiography and standard magnetic resonance imaging scans, but CMR has important pitfalls relating to evaluation of A3 and P3 scallops, and suffers from poor visualization of calcification and lower spatial resolution than echo. CMR with standard planes cannot replace CMR with longitudinal planes or echo for the evaluation of specific scallop pathology in severe primary MR.

We report a case of a 66-year-old man with known ischaemic heart disease, diabetes mellitus and stage 4 kidney disease who was admitted to our tertiary centre with shortness of breath and atrial flutter. Transoesophageal echocardiography (TOE) was without suspicion of endocarditis. During hospitalisation, the patient suffered a nosocomial infection in a peripheral vascular catheter caused by Staphylococcus aureus. TOE after positive blood cultures revealed a new vegetation on the pulmonary valve that resolved after antibiotic treatment.

The growing use of ambulatory blood pressure monitoring has led to an increased awareness of the two types of discrepancy between office blood pressure and ambulatory blood pressure, called white coat hypertension (WCH) and masked hypertension (MH). Based on several longitudinal studies, WCH is viewed as a condition with a relatively low cardiovascular risk, whereas patients with MH have an increased risk of cardiovascular morbidity and mortality. Two studies documented a gradually increased risk from normotension over WCH and MH to sustained hypertension.
